$1,375/month

10061 SW 99th Terrace, Ocala, FL 34481

Save Contact

Sold Price:

$1,375

Sold Date: 09/13/2023

10061 SW 99th Terrace Ocala, FL 34481

Sold MLS# O6123266

2 beds 1 baths 960 sq ft Single Family